Description

The Dorothy M. Hagan and Juanita W. Hicks Achievement Scholarship was established by the family of Dorothy M. Hagan and Juanita W. Hicks to provide financial assistance, based on merit and financial need, to continuing CSUF undergraduate students.

Eligibility

  • This scholarship is open to new and continuing CSUF undergraduate students in any course of study.Criteria:
  • Merit 
  • Financial need 
  • Fulltime 
  • 3.0 GPA 
  • Work 20 Hours a Week or More

Application

Application deadline

12 Apr 2025

Complete the online scholarship application athttp://www.fullerton.edu/financialaid/_resources/pdf/scholarships/Application.pdf, or,submit a completed application and materials in a sealed envelope to: Hagan-Hicks Scholarship,Attn: Catherine Ward, UH-183A.; 

Submit two letters of recommendation; one of the lettersmust be from a CSUF faculty member; for incoming first-time student applicants, this lettershould be from a high school teacher or counselor.

The second letter, for all applicants, shouldbe from a current/recent employer/supervisor at a campus or community service organizationin which the applicant has been actively involved; 

Complete a Free Application for FederalStudent Aid (FAFSA), or have one on file with the Office of Financial Aid, to establish financial need.
